Overview

This entry describes a novel antisense noncoding transcript located opposite to the RBPJ gene. Antisense transcripts are RNA molecules transcribed from the strand opposite to a protein-coding gene and can regulate the expression of their sense partner gene, in this case, RBPJ, by mechanisms such as transcriptional interference, RNA duplex formation, modulation of chromatin state, and effects on transcript stability or translation[4][7]. There is no standardized functional characterization for this specific transcript, and it is not recognized as a conventional therapeutic target such as a receptor, enzyme, or transporter. Instead, it may play a regulatory role influencing the transcriptional dynamics of RBPJ. RBPJ itself is a well-characterized transcription factor central to Notch signaling pathways, but this antisense transcript’s biological significance is unclear and not clinically actionable at present[1][6][3].
